Bootstrap 徽章
引言
Bootstrap 是一个流行的前端框架,它提供了一套丰富的工具和组件,用于快速开发响应式和移动设备优先的网页。在 Bootstrap 的众多组件中,徽章(Badges)是一个简单但非常有用的元素,用于突出显示和传达信息,如未读消息的数量、通知或状态标记。本文将详细介绍 Bootstrap 徽章的用法、样式和最佳实践。
什么是 Bootstrap 徽章?
Bootstrap 徽章是一个小的标签,通常用来显示数量或状态。它们通常附加在按钮、导航链接或其他元素上,以吸引用户的注意。徽章可以用来显示消息计数、警告、提示或其他重要信息。
基本用法
在 Bootstrap 中,创建一个徽章非常简单。你只需要将文本包裹在一个带有 badge
类的元素中即可。例如,使用一个 span
元素:
<span class="badge">4</span>
这个徽章将显示数字 4
。你可以将这个徽章放置在任何你想要强调信息的地方。
徽章的颜色
Bootstrap 提供了几种预定义的徽章颜色,用于不同的场景和目的。你可以通过添加相应的类来改变徽章的颜色:
badge-primary
:主要徽章,通常用于重要信息。badge-secondary
:次要徽章,用于不那么重要的信息。badge-success
:成功徽章,用于表示成功或积极的操作。badge-danger
:危险徽章,用于表示错误或危险的操作。badge-warning
:警告徽章,用于表示需要注意的信息。badge-info
:信息徽章,用于一般信息。badge-light
:浅色徽章,用于在深色背景上使用。badge-dark
:深色徽章,用于在浅色背景上使用。
徽章的样式
Bootstrap 的徽章有一些默认的样式,如圆角和相对较小的字体大小。你可以通过自定义 CSS 来进一步定制徽章的外观。例如,你可以改变徽章的背景颜色、字体大小或边框半径。
徽章的最佳实践
- 清晰性:确保徽章上的信息清晰可见,避免使用过小的字体或与背景颜色相近的颜色。
- 一致性:在应用程序中一致地使用徽章,以便用户能够快速识别和理解它们。
- 适度使用:不要过度使用徽章,这可能会分散用户的注意力或降低它们的重要性。
- 响应式设计:确保徽章在不同的设备和屏幕尺寸上都能良好地显示。
结论
Bootstrap 徽章是一个简单但功能强大的组件,可以帮助你突出显示重要信息并改善用户体验。通过遵循最佳实践和适当的样式,你可以确保徽章在你的应用程序中有效地工作。